"By shopping at one of our Unique Eugene stores on June 18, you, <br /> too. are investing in our communiiy, both by buying local first and contributing to RiverPlay!" <br /> Phase one of the RiverPiay playground includes a mammoth play replica of Skinner Butte, two <br /> water features, the millrace and the rain circle, which represents the origins of the Willamette River, a <br /> child-operated ferry, stagecoach, and the pioneer village. Subsequent phases will include an ancient <br /> history sand dig, miniature Willamette River, old mill play structure, and Kalapuya village.
